Matrix working has become common in large complex organizations. This means that how we deal with the challenges of managing people within this complex form of organisation structure makes the difference between being successful or not. 

This programme will focus on the skills needed to manage the complexities associated with aligning multiple roles and objectives, influencing more than one boss and dealing with people in the matrix team.

Target Audience

This course would benefit anyone who has to influence without position power – anyone who has no direct reports and operates as an individual contributor or specialist and works on a day to day basis with peers or the next level up.
